Cost Allocation and Taxation at Nonprofit Organizations Nonprofit organizations are exemptfrom federal income tax except for income from any activities that are unrelated to the nonprofit’scharitable purpose. An example is the use of a laboratory for both tax-exempt basic medical researchand for testing a taxable product for commercial pharmaceutical firms. A concern in these cases is thattax-exempt nonprofit organizations will be able to compete unfairly with for-profit firms because oftheir tax-exempt status. The key argument is that common costs for the nonprofit’s exempt and businessactivities will be used to “subsidize” the for-profit business (in this case, the taxable product testing).Required How would cost allocation play a role in affecting the operating results of a nonprofit organization that has both business and charitable activities?
